NORTH ANDOVER, MA — This year's Fourth of July fireworks and fesitvities blast off on Sunday July 1. Join the North Andover community at the North Andover Middle School at 9 p.m. for a firework spectacle.
There's also an entire day of festivities planned for the North Andover Town Common at Main Street. Activities include a doll carriage and bike parade, music, a beer garden, pie eating contest, and more.
A schedule of activities can be found below:

- 10 a.m. to 4 p.m. - Doll carriage and bike parade, pie eating contest, live music, vendors and crafts
- 11 a.m. to 2 p.m. - Live TV show at the North Andover CAM Booth
- 12 p.m. to 8 p.m. - Beer garden from Ipswitch Ale
- 9 p.m. Fireworks at the middle school field.
